Comprehending the Causes of Foggy Windows
Foggy windows are primarily triggered by moisture getting caught between the panes of double-glazed windows. This problem is typically a result of sealant failure. Below are essential aspects that can contribute to foggy windows:
- Seal Failure: The most common reason for foggy windows. The sealant that holds the insulated glass panes together can use down over time.
- Temperature level Changes: Rapid temperature variations can warp window frames and cause seals to break.
- Age of the Window: Older windows are more prone to moisture accumulation due to use and tear.
- Improper Installation: Poor window setup can cause misalignment and seal failure.
Repairing Foggy Windows
Repairing foggy windows can differ from DIY solutions to professional services. Below is an in-depth take a look at numerous repair options:
1. DIY Solutions to Foggy Windows
If the fogging is mild, house owners might consider the following DIY approaches:
A. Desiccant Packs
These packs absorb wetness and can in some cases be placed between the panes if there is a gain access to point.
B. Use a Hairdryer
Carefully warming the glass can evaporate the wetness. This is a momentary service and must be utilized with caution.
C. Sealant Resealing
For older windows, resealing may be necessary. Clear the area of old sealant and use a fresh bead to avoid additional moisture entry.
2. Professional Services
For more substantial fogging, professional services may be needed. Here are some common procedures:
A. Glass Replacement
In extreme cases, changing the whole window system may be the most reliable service.
B. Window Defogging Services
Specific business concentrate on removing fog between glass panes without the requirement to change the entire window.
C. Full Window Replacement
If the windows are too old or damaged, think about a full replacement for improved performance and aesthetics.

Prevention Tips
Avoiding fogged windows is possible with a few well-considered modifications and maintenance practices. Here's a list of strategies to help keep the integrity of your windows:
- Regular Maintenance: Periodically examine window seals for wear.
- Purchase Quality Windows: Choose greater quality, energy-efficient windows that are less prone to seal failure.
- Climate Control: Keep indoor humidity levels balanced to prevent excessive wetness.
- Proper Installation: Ensure windows are installed by professionals to avoid misalignment.
FAQs about Foggy Window Repair
Q1: Can foggy windows be fixed, or do I require to change them?
A: Many foggy windows can be fixed. Solutions vary from DIY approaches to professional defogging services. Nevertheless, if the window is severely harmed, a replacement may be more sensible.
Q2: How much does it usually cost to repair foggy windows?
A: DIY repairs can be provided for under ₤ 50, while professional services can vary from ₤ 100 to over ₤ 500 depending on the extent of the fogging and required repairs.
Q3: Is a window defogging service worth it?
A: Yes, if done by experts, window defogging can bring back exposure and extend the life of your windows without the requirement for full replacement.
Q4: How can I prevent windows from misting in the very first location?
A: Regular maintenance, purchasing quality windows, keeping humidity levels steady, and making sure correct installation can all assist prevent fogging.
Q5: Will my house owner's insurance coverage cover foggy window repair?
A: It depends on the policy. Some may cover window repairs due to seal failure or storm damage but contact your insurance service provider for specifics.
